Your John Fluke Model 8024A is a pocket-sized digital
multimeter that is ideally suited for application in the
field, laboratory, shop, or home. Some of the features of
your instrument are:
FUNCTIONS: All standard VOM measurement functions — ac/dc
voltage, ac/dc current, resistance — plus:
Conductance: A new multimeter function that allows fast,
accurate, noise-free resistance measurements up to 10,000 ΜΩ.
Temperature: Used with a K-type thermocouple, this function
provides direct display in degrees Celsius for K-type
thermocouples.
Peak-Hold: Provides short-term memory for capturing the peak
value of transient ac or dc signals such as motor starting
current.
Continuity: Provides an immediate visual and audible
indication when continuity is detected (use for passive
circuit testing).
Level Detector: Senses logic levels and other active signals
less than 250V dc or ac rms. Visual and audible indications
of the results are provided.
RANGE for each function has:
Full autopolarity
Overrange indication
Effective protection from overloads.
Dual slope integration measurement technique to ensure
noise-free measurements.
